Le Present (Present Tense) Conjugation of the French Verb arracher
Introduction to the verb arracher
to pull up/to tear off/to snatch
Pronunciation: /a.ʁa.ʃe/
Origin: From the Old French “aracher”, which comes from the Vulgar Latin word “arradicāre”, meaning “to uproot”.
Usage in everyday French:
- Je vais arracher les mauvaises herbes dans le jardin. (I am going to pull up the weeds in the garden.)
- Il faut arracher cette affiche du mur. (We need to tear off this poster from the wall.)
- Le voleur a réussi à arracher son sac à main. (The thief managed to snatch her handbag.)

Table of the Present Tense Conjugation of arracher
Pronoun | Conjugation | Short Example | English Translation |
---|---|---|---|
Je | arrache | J’arrache les mauvaises herbes. | I pull out the weeds. |
Tu | arraches | Tu arraches la page du livre. | You tear out the page of the book. |
Il | arrache | Il arrache les affiches. | He tears off the posters. |
Elle | arrache | Elle arrache les étiquettes. | She rips off the labels. |
On | arrache | On arrache les fleurs. | One pulls out the flowers. |
Nous | arrachons | Nous arrachons les mauvaises herbes. | We pull out the weeds. |
Vous | arrachez | Vous arrachez les pages du cahier. | You tear out the pages of the notebook. |
Ils | arrachent | Ils arrachent les affiches. | They tear off the posters. |
Elles | arrachent | Elles arrachent les étiquettes. | They rip off the labels. |
